Output 8d8ea05282d0636330ec2e96c14ccb685afbc085f28354fc679f0af4c8fc8ff2:47

value
32990
script pubkey
OP_0 OP_PUSHBYTES_20 109c40bec0aa678c4b1978c9e6251a3b628ecc56
address
bc1qzzwyp0kq4fnccjce0ry7vfg68d3ganzkmjfkfw
transaction
8d8ea05282d0636330ec2e96c14ccb685afbc085f28354fc679f0af4c8fc8ff2
confirmations
65019
spent
true